/*
 * Client setup for the Splitgate assignment service.
 * External plugins must fetch experiment assignments through this client only;
 * never cache assignments across sessions, as bucket weights can be rebalanced
 * hourly by the Larkmoor experimentation team. Always pass the stable subject
 * identifier, not the session token, or users will flip variants mid-experiment.
 * The client retries twice with jittered backoff on 5xx responses.
 * Authentication uses the internal service key provided below.
 */

API key for yagef-bagef: zpat23_RTEspBOEmE9eDRK8oFjwnRE

Minutes — Management Meeting, Franchise Agreement

Present: Ostrand, Vella, Kern. The Bramwick franchise agreement was reviewed clause by clause. Royalty rate agreed at 5.5%; territory limited to the Selwyn corridor. Kern to finalise exit provisions before signature. Vella flagged branding compliance as a risk. For the incoming director's awareness, the underlying commercial strategy is recorded below.

internal memo for hahif-hahaf: Headcount on the Zorwyn team goes from 9 to 100 by the end of October. Gross margin on Zorwyn came in at 5 percent against a plan of 10 percent.

## Who to ping about GiftNote

Welcome aboard! GiftNote is our donation-receipt mailer for the Larchfield Fund. Template tweaks go to the comms folks; delivery failures and bounce weirdness go to the platform crew. Don't push template changes on Fridays — receipts batch over the weekend. For anything GiftNote-related, start with the address below.

billing contact of kaweg-tajeg = drudor.lamion.oliath@torvalabs.test

## Formula sandbox tuning

User-supplied formulas in Gridmoor execute inside a restricted interpreter with hard ceilings on time, memory, and call depth. Reviewers should confirm any change to these ceilings is justified in the PR description, since raising them widens the abuse surface. Defaults were chosen from production traces. The current limits are as follows.

limits module of tafog-fawip:
WEIGHTS = {
    "julix": 57,
    "lamys": 992,
    "kasvan": 209,
    "quenok": 750,
    "alddor": 259,
    "oliath": 1009,
    "wenix": 815,
}